Default Foods if you "Go to the Gym" Or Exercise - 06-12-2007, 01:08 AM

Hey you always want a "Sufficient" amount of protein rich foods. But do not over-do the protein intake either. Lean Sources of protein, and some good carbs and fats. You need all of these macronutrients to stay healthy and to mainly stay alive!
